A recent suggested change to the IFS code has shown that the userspace
API needs a bit more work, see:
https://lore.kernel.org/platform-driver-x86/20220708151938.986530-1-jithu.joseph@intel.com/
Mark it as BROKEN before 5.19 ships, to give ourselves one more
kernel-devel cycle to get the userspace API right.

drivers/platform/x86/intel/ifs/Kconfig | 3 +++
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+)
diff --git a/drivers/platform/x86/intel/ifs/Kconfig b/drivers/platform/x86/intel/ifs/Kconfig
index 7ce896434b8f..c341a27cc1a3 100644
--- a/drivers/platform/x86/intel/ifs/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/platform/x86/intel/ifs/Kconfig
@@ -1,6 +1,9 @@
config INTEL_IFS
tristate "Intel In Field Scan"
depends on X86 && CPU_SUP_INTEL && 64BIT && SMP
+ # Discussion on the list has shown that the sysfs API needs a bit
+ # more work, mark this as broken for now
+ depends on BROKEN
select INTEL_IFS_DEVICE
help
Enable support for the In Field Scan capability in select
